Market Overview
The Video CODECs Market encompasses technologies designed to encode and decode digital video data, fundamentally enabling the compression and decompression of video streams. CODEC, an acronym for COder-DECoder, plays an indispensable role in reducing the immense file sizes of raw video, making it feasible for storage, transmission over networks, and efficient playback across various devices. Without effective video compression, the modern digital ecosystem, characterized by pervasive streaming services, video conferencing, and broadcast media, would be unsustainable due to prohibitive bandwidth and storage requirements.
This market is vital for industries heavily reliant on digital visual content, impacting sectors such as media and entertainment, telecommunications, consumer electronics, surveillance, and automotive. From the seamless delivery of high-resolution content on streaming platforms to the efficient communication in telehealth and remote work environments, video CODECs are the silent workhorses ensuring quality, speed, and accessibility. The continuous advancement in CODEC technology directly influences user experience, operational costs for content providers, and the overall capacity of digital infrastructure. The ongoing demand for higher video quality, coupled with the proliferation of video-enabled devices and applications, underscores the indispensable nature of this market, positioning it as a cornerstone of the digital economy.

Key Market Segments
The Video CODECs Market is broadly segmented based on the type of CODEC technologies and their diverse applications, each addressing specific industry needs and technical requirements.
Types:
H.264 & H.265: These are two of the most widely adopted video coding standards. H.264, also known as Advanced Video Coding (AVC), revolutionized video compression by offering significantly better efficiency than its predecessors. H.265, or High-Efficiency Video Coding (HEVC), built upon H.264, providing even greater compression ratios, particularly beneficial for 4K and 8K content while maintaining visual quality.
DivX: A brand of video compression technologies and codecs, DivX gained popularity for its ability to compress large video files into smaller sizes suitable for distribution over the internet, primarily impacting the early digital video consumption landscape.
AVS: Audio Video Coding Standard (AVS) is a set of technical standards for digital audio and video compression developed in China. It provides an alternative to international standards, catering to specific regional market requirements and applications.
Others: This category encompasses a variety of other CODECs and emerging compression technologies, including AV1, VP9, and proprietary solutions developed for specific ecosystems or niche applications. These alternatives often compete on factors such as royalty-free licensing, performance, or suitability for next-generation immersive experiences.
Applications:
Television Broadcasting System: Video CODECs are fundamental to modern television broadcasting, enabling the efficient transmission of high-definition and ultra-high-definition programming over terrestrial, satellite, and cable networks. They facilitate the delivery of diverse content channels and contribute to the evolution of broadcast standards.
DVD: Digital Versatile Discs (DVDs) utilized early video CODEC technologies to store and play back standard-definition video content. While a legacy format, its historical significance in popularizing compressed digital video for home consumption is undeniable.
Other: This broad category includes a vast array of applications such as over-the-top (OTT) streaming services, video conferencing, video surveillance systems, mobile video applications, gaming, virtual and augmented reality platforms, automotive infotainment systems, and professional video production and post-production workflows. The demand for CODECs across these diverse uses underscores their pervasive integration into the digital landscape.

Market Trends and Drivers
The Video CODECs Market is currently undergoing transformative shifts, driven by a confluence of technological advancements, evolving consumer behaviors, and increasing demand across various industries. Understanding these trends and drivers is crucial for stakeholders aiming to capitalize on future opportunities.
One of the most significant trends is the escalating demand for higher resolution content. The widespread adoption of 4K displays and the emergence of 8K televisions are pushing the boundaries of video compression. CODECs capable of efficiently handling these ultra-high-definition formats without compromising visual fidelity are gaining prominence. This trend is closely tied to the growth of online streaming platforms that continually strive to offer superior visual experiences to their subscribers.
The proliferation of live streaming and interactive video applications represents another key driver. Events like online gaming, virtual concerts, educational webinars, and real-time communication platforms require ultra-low latency video delivery. This necessitates CODECs that can compress and decompress video with minimal delay, making real-time interaction seamless and engaging. Advances in hardware-accelerated encoding and decoding are crucial for meeting these stringent performance requirements.
The integration of Artificial Intelligence (AI) and Machine Learning (ML) into video compression workflows is an emerging trend. AI can optimize encoding parameters dynamically, predict content characteristics for more efficient compression, and even enhance video quality through super-resolution techniques post-decoding. This intelligent approach to compression promises further efficiency gains and improved visual quality, especially for adaptive bitrate streaming.
Another significant trend is the shift towards cloud-based video processing and CODEC solutions. As video workflows become increasingly complex and require scalable infrastructure, cloud platforms offer the flexibility and computational power needed for encoding, transcoding, and distributing vast amounts of video content. This trend reduces the upfront capital expenditure for media companies and enables more agile content delivery pipelines.
The expansion of video consumption on mobile devices remains a powerful driver. With varying network conditions and device capabilities, CODECs must be highly adaptable to deliver optimal video experiences across a spectrum of mobile environments. This fuels the demand for CODECs that support adaptive bitrate streaming and are optimized for power efficiency on portable devices.
Regulatory changes and industry initiatives promoting more efficient video standards also contribute to market growth. For instance, efforts to reduce bandwidth consumption for broadcast and streaming services encourage the adoption of newer, more efficient CODECs. The increasing demand for video content in diverse sectors, including healthcare (telemedicine), education (e-learning), and automotive (autonomous vehicle sensors, infotainment), is expanding the application base for advanced video compression technologies, further solidifying the market's upward trajectory. Regional Insights
The global Video CODECs Market exhibits diverse growth patterns across different geographical regions, primarily influenced by technological infrastructure, digital adoption rates, content consumption trends, and regulatory landscapes.
North America consistently holds a significant share of the market, primarily driven by its robust technological infrastructure, high internet penetration, and the presence of major content creators, streaming service providers, and technology innovators. Early adoption of advanced video technologies, strong investment in research and development, and a mature digital media ecosystem contribute to its dominance. The demand for 4K/8K content, interactive streaming, and professional video solutions is particularly strong in this region.
Europe also represents a substantial market, characterized by a well-established broadcasting industry, growing online streaming platforms, and a strong focus on data privacy and efficient network utilization. Western European countries are early adopters of new video compression standards, driven by both consumer demand for high-quality content and the need for efficient spectrum management in broadcasting. The ongoing digital transformation across industries further propels the demand for advanced CODECs.
The Asia Pacific region is poised for the fastest growth in the Video CODECs Market. This accelerated expansion is attributed to several key factors, including a massive and rapidly growing internet user base, particularly in emerging economies like India and Southeast Asia. The proliferation of affordable smartphones, increasing mobile data consumption, and the surge in local content creation and consumption are significant drivers. Additionally, the region's strong manufacturing base for consumer electronics and telecommunications equipment, coupled with substantial investments in 5G infrastructure, further stimulates the demand for efficient video compression technologies. China, with its vast digital ecosystem and the development of indigenous CODEC standards like AVS, plays a pivotal role in shaping the regional market. The rising popularity of online gaming, e-learning, and social media platforms heavily reliant on video content also fuels growth in this dynamic region.
Other regions, including Latin America, the Middle East, and Africa, are also experiencing growth, albeit at a different pace, driven by improving internet infrastructure, increasing smartphone penetration, and the nascent but growing demand for digital entertainment and communication services.
